About the role
The Perinatal and Infant Mental Health Specialist provides intensive community based mental health interventions for women with major mental illness during the perinatal period and an advanced nursing/allied health service as an expert in the community mental health specialty field and facilitates linkages and relationships with Local Health District nurses/midwives, multidisciplinary teams and medical officers to support patient management.
Providing assessment, care planning and review of patients in collaboration with the primary service providers to ensure that evidence based practice is utilised. The CNC2/Senior Allied Health clinician is responsible for the provision of expert clinical advice, coordination, leadership and consultancy services within the defined catchment area and target populations within Northern NSW Local Health District (NNSWLHD).
